“Understanding the Uttarakhand Judiciary Exam Format: A Strategic Overview”
Stage 1: Preliminary Examination
Format: Objective-type questions, multiple-choice.
Focus Areas:
- General Knowledge (50 marks)
- Current events
- International law
- Neutrality
- Indian Constitution
- Law (150 marks)
- Indian Penal Code
- Code of Civil Procedure
- Code of Criminal Procedure
- Indian Evidence Act
- Transfer of Property Act
- Hindu Law
- Muslim Law
Purpose: Screening test to shortlist candidates for Mains.
Key Insight: Focus on building a strong foundation in law subjects, practice objective-type questions, and manage time effectively. Negative marking is 0.25 marks for each incorrect answer.
Stage 2: Mains Examination
Format: Descriptive type questions
Focus Areas:
- Paper I: (150 marks)
- Current events
- International law
- Recent legislation
- Paper II: Language (100 marks)
- Translation from English to Hindi and vice versa
- Precis writing
- Paper III: Substantive Law (200 marks)
- Law of Contracts
- Law of Partnership
- Law concerning easements and torts
- Transfer of Property Act
- Paper IV: Evidence & Procedure (200 marks)
- Indian Evidence Act
- Code of Civil Procedure
- Code of Criminal Procedure
- Paper V: Revenue & Criminal Law (200 marks)
- Indian Penal Code
- U.P. Zamindari Abolition and Land Reforms Act (as applicable in Uttarakhand)
- Paper VI: Basic Knowledge of Computer Operation (100 marks)
- Practical examination of MS Office and Windows.
Purpose: Assess in-depth knowledge and application of law
Key Insight: Develop strong writing skills, focus on legal language, and practice answering previous years' questions.
Stage 3: Interview (Personality Test)
Format: Viva-voce, personality assessment
Focus Areas:
- General knowledge
- Personality traits
- Communication skills
- Legal aptitude
- Understanding of current legal and social issues
Purpose: Assess suitability for the role
Key Insight: Develop strong communication skills, stay updated on current events, and demonstrate confidence and clarity in responses.
